Menu Close

Articles on High school

Displaying 41 - 60 of 152 articles

Ontario’s elementary and secondary school curricula now include coding, a most basic aspect of learning programming. (Shutterstock)

Why elementary and high school students should learn computer programming

Teaching computer programming to youth can prepare them for the future job market, promote equity in tech professions and develop students’ computational thinking skills.
High school students have studied many of the same books for generations. Is it time for a change? Andrew_Howe via Getty Images

These high school ‘classics’ have been taught for generations – could they be on their way out?

An English professor takes a critical look at why today’s students are assigned the same books that were assigned decades ago – and why American school curricula are so difficult to change.
The core of education is to enable young learners to be kind, giving members of society. David Brewster/Star Tribune via Getty Images

Why do kids have to go to school?

The core principle of education is to enable students to become kind, giving and contributing members of their community and the world.
Career technical education courses are linked to higher rates of school engagement for high schoolers from low-income backgrounds. Maskot/Getty Images

Career-based classes keep students more engaged

Students from low-income backgrounds fare better when they are able to take career and technical classes in STEM, new research shows.

Top contributors

More